Handover: Tindale template rendering

For whoever picks this up — the Tindale renderer is fine at steady state but degrades badly when partials nest more than four levels deep. I traced it to the compile cache being keyed per-request instead of per-template; the fix is half-done on the perf branch. Benchmarks live in the harness under bench/templates; run them before and after any change, or you'll regress silently. Notes on what I tried, what failed, and the flamegraphs are all collected on the internal page below.

wiki page, tahaf-tajog: https://jira.ordindyn.corp/pipeline

### Step 4: Repoint the health checks

Once Brackenfeed v2 is live in the Norwick cluster, the Tollgate load balancer will still be probing the old /ping path, which v2 doesn't serve. That means the LB will happily drain every healthy node — don't panic, just update the probe target before flipping traffic. The new endpoint is /healthz and it returns 200 only after the warm-up cache finishes, so give it about 90 seconds. Apply the probe settings shown below to the Tollgate pool.

service settings:
[casax]
port = 6379
team = rusir
host = casax.zemvarhq.corp
region = outer-4
access_code = ac_9808ce
timeout_ms = 1500

**Q: We're moving our cron jobs into Driftline, the workflow engine — do I have to rewrite everything?**

Mostly no. For simple jobs, wrap the existing script in a Driftline task and set the schedule trigger; done. The real work is jobs that assume exclusive execution — Driftline may run retries concurrently, so add idempotency guards. Also, drop any homegrown locking; the engine handles that. Worked examples, common pitfalls, and the migration checklist from the platform team are all collected on one internal page.

runbook for tajep-yahig: https://artifactory.lumictech.corp/repo

Minutes – Management Meeting, Corvato Mills

Heads of department: we talked through the Ashpool plant capacity question. Short version — demand's up, the second press line looks justified, but Rhea wants firmer numbers before we commit. Ops will deliver a costed proposal in two weeks; hiring stays on hold until then. The confidential planning note appears just below.

management briefing: Only 5 of the 80 pilot accounts renewed Zorix, so a churn review is set for October 1.